My partner took me here after coming here themselves in August, and introduced me to some of their favorite dishes from their previous experience. We mainly ordered starters, and that was enough in helping me make a decision on how I'd rate this place.

Among all the starters, my favorite was the blue crab claws, primarily because it had a very nice white wine butter sauce that was elevated by garlic, shallots, and cherry tomatoes that provided a ton of flavor. Not only did the crab claws tasted great in the sauce, but also I used some of the bread from the bruschetta to dip in the sauce. Another favorite was the fried green tomatoes which had a good amount of crabmeat along with champagne crème that elevated the taste. In between dishes, the mocktail Rosey Cheeks served as a great palate cleanser because of the rose water, which had very strong taste.

The bruschetta was great as well, with a good amount of crabmeat included along with enough balsamic vinegar. There wasn't enough olive oil or basil, though, which made it a bit worse than expected. The crawfish and sausage mac & cheese was too plain because it didn't seem like the layers under the top were seasoned enough. The chef's fish sandwich had too much tartar sauce, and even if the tartar sauce tasted good, the fish itself didn't really taste seasoned. The Grace Pink Drink under the mocktail section tasted a bit watered down, because it didn't taste enough like any of the ingredients listed, ranging from watermelon Redbull to guava syrup.

Overall I think this place has some solid food and I am open to visiting in the future when I am back in Mobile. Next time, I would love to try some of their large plates or just dishes from their dinner menu, which seemed to be highlights according to other customers.
